What is the Average Mechanical Engineer Salary in Spain in 2026?
The average gross salary for a Mechanical Engineer in Spain is €36,000 per year (mid-level). After taxes, the estimated net take-home is approximately €26,000.
- Median salary: €36,000/yr gross (€26,000 net) for mid-level
- Range: €28,000 to €45,000
- Spain ranks #5 in the EU for Mechanical Engineer pay
